I am new to diesel vehicles - I recently bought a 2003 Ford Excursion 7.3 Power Stroke. It has 8 inch skyjacker lift w/ 38" Toyo's - a 5" exhaust and I just put a Juice w/ attitude in it (which I found out today was a mistake).

I presently have the vehicle in the shop putting on a three stage torque converter and doing so work on the transmission. I am looking at the DieselSite - high pressure oil pump and would like to know what other 7.3 owners recommend to get the best performance and gas mileage form the truck. I now know the Juice has to go - or be set to stock for the gauges but what else should I do to this thing. Any recommendations or experiences would be appreciated.
